Spectroscopic and structural characterization of pascoite
Authors:Reddy G Udayabhaskara  Reddy R Ramasubba  Reddy S Lakshmi  Frost Ray L  Endo Tamio
Institution:Department of Physics, S.V.D. College, Kadapa 516003, India.
Abstract:Pascoite mineral having yellow-orange colour of Colorado, USA origin has been characterized by EPR, optical and NIR spectroscopy. The colour dark red-orange to yellow-orange colour of the pascoite indicates that the mineral contain mixed valency of vanadium. The optical spectrum exhibits a number of electronic bands due to presence of VO(II) ions in the mineral. From EPR studies, the parameters of g, A are evaluated and the data confirm that the ion is in distorted octahedron. Optical absorption studies reveal that two sets of VO(II) is in distorted octahedron. The bands in NIR spectra are due to the overtones and combinations of water molecules.
